Grapetooth Announces Debut Album & Shares Video for New Single “Red Wine”

More dope, fresh music out of Chicago coming your way! Grapetooth, the Chi duo of Chris Bailoni and Clay Frankel (of Twin Peaks) has formally announced its self-titled debut album set for release on November 9th via Polyvinyl Record Co. Check out more details below.

Along with that announcement, Grapetooth have unleashed the music video for their third single, “Red Wine.” The lo-fi, home video-quality clip excellently captures the chill & throwback fun vibes that surround these dudes.

“This video worked out the same way our first two did – we always wait ‘til it gets dark then go out with a camera, some weird lights, and a couple outfits and see what happens. This time we got a convertible and drove around the city. We come up with ideas on the spot when we’re shooting – less planning works in our favor – we’re super happy with it. Jackson [James] did an amazing job!”

If you want to check these guys out live, especially after their antics at their sold out show at Lincoln Hall got shut down early, fans have a chance to see them at their New York City gig where they’ll be playing Baby’s All Right on September 28th. They’ve also just announced a hometown headline show at Thalia Hall.
